1. An implantable endoluminal prosthesis adapted for placement within a body, comprising:
- a stent member having an outer surface when said stent member is in an expanded configuration;
a graft member;
a first tape member having a first width and a second tape member having a second width different from said first width;
said first tape member covering only a portion of said outer surface of said stent member;
said second tape member covering only a portion of said outer surface of said stent member;
at least one of said first tape member and said second tape member being bonded to said graft member and securing the stent member and graft member together.

Abstract
The invention consists of an endoluminal prosthesis adapted for placement at a bifurcation site within the body. The stent or stent-graft may be constructed to have segments of differing structural properties. A section of the stent-graft may be constructed to have a single-lumen tubular stent member covering a multilumen graft member. The stent-graft may comprise at least two modular components adapted for in situ assembly. An extended cylindrical interference fit may be used to seal the modular components.
